3-401.

(c) (1) In adopting sound level limits and noise control rules and
regulations, the Department shall consider, among other things:

(i) The residential, commercial, or industrial nature of the area
affected;

(ii) Zoning;

(iii) The nature and source of various kinds of noise;

(iv) The degree of noise reduction that may be attained and
maintained using the best available technology;

(v) Accepted scientific and professional methods for measurement
of sound levels; and

(vi) The cost of compliance with the sound level limits.

(2) The sound level limits adopted under this subsection shall be
consistent with the environmental noise standards adopted by the Department.

(3)     The sound level limits and noise control rules and regulations
adopted under this subsection may not prohibit trapshooting or other target shooting
on any range or other property in Frederick County that the Frederick County
Department of Planning and Zoning has approved as a place for those sporting
events.
